The Star of David, a prominent symbol in Jewish culture, features a six-pointed star formed by the overlapping of two equilateral triangles. This design represents the connection between the divine and the earthly, embodying the unity of opposites. Often associated with Judaism, the Star of David is used in various contexts, including religious ceremonies, art, and cultural expressions.
